加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.9399.com.cn/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ux下数据库高效运行的环境融合策略

发布时间:2026-05-16 08:13:45 所属栏目:Linux 来源:DaWei
导读:  在Linux系统中部署数据库时,性能优化的核心在于环境配置与系统资源的协同管理。合理设置文件系统类型是关键一步,推荐使用ext4或XFS,它们对大容量数据读写具有更高的效率,并支持更精细的权限与日志控制。避免

  在Linux系统中部署数据库时,性能优化的核心在于环境配置与系统资源的协同管理。合理设置文件系统类型是关键一步,推荐使用ext4或XFS,它们对大容量数据读写具有更高的效率,并支持更精细的权限与日志控制。避免使用默认的ext3,因其缺乏对高并发场景的优化能力。


  内存管理直接影响数据库响应速度。通过调整Linux的内存回收策略,可减少因频繁页交换导致的延迟。建议将vm.swappiness值设为10以下,降低系统主动将内存页面换出到磁盘的倾向。同时,为数据库进程预留足够的物理内存,避免与其他服务争抢资源。


  I/O调度器的选择同样重要。对于固态硬盘(SSD),推荐使用noop或deadline调度器,以减少不必要的队列等待,提升随机读写性能。而对于机械硬盘,则可选用deadline或cfq,平衡吞吐量与响应时间。可通过修改/sys/block/sd/queue/scheduler来动态切换。


  网络参数的优化也不容忽视。数据库常依赖网络通信,适当调高TCP缓冲区大小(如net.core.rmem_max、wmem_max)并启用TCP快速打开(TFO),有助于缓解高并发连接下的延迟问题。同时,关闭不必要的网络服务,减少系统中断干扰。


2026AI模拟图,仅供参考

  定期监控系统负载与数据库运行状态,借助工具如htop、iostat、vmstat和数据库自带的性能视图,能及时发现瓶颈。结合systemd服务配置,实现数据库的自动启动与资源限制,确保稳定运行。


  综合来看,高效运行不仅依赖数据库本身,更取决于操作系统层面的深度适配。通过精准配置文件系统、内存、I/O及网络参数,形成一套协调一致的运行环境,才能真正释放数据库在Linux平台上的全部潜力。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章